Hyderabad: HMRL Managing Director NVS Reddy on Thursday launched Paytm's QR-code based Metro ticketing system at Metro Rail Bhavan here.

Speaking on the occasion, NVS Reddy said, with the launch of QR code-based ticketing system, "We have taken a step forward towards creating urban mobility solutions that are future-ready. We believe that by offering these tech-powered solutions we will serve the transit needs of commuters more efficiently and seamlessly". He also said that the new service would give commuters in Hyderabad a new option to travel seamlessly and avoid long queues to buy tokens at Metro stations. They can now simply purchase a QR ticket on their Paytm app, which can be displayed at the Automatic Fare Collection (AFC) gates to proceed for the journey.

L&T Metro Rail Hyderabad Limited MD K V B Reddy said, "The launch of mobile QR ticketing on Hyderabad Metro in partnership with Paytm help people of Hyderabad to book digital ticket seamlessly and create mark in industry. This feature will help over 14 lakh smart card holders using Metro services to book Single, Return, Store Value & Trip Pass ticket using the Paytm app and experience seamless connectivity. These tickets can also be pre-booked and come with a validity of one day. The company further plans to extend this service to metro-feeder buses to ensure last-mile connectivity in the city. Speaking on the occasion, Abhay Sharma, Senior Vice President, Paytm said, "The QR-code based ticket booking feature launched in partnership with Hyderabad Metro Rail on our app would help in reducing congestion on the ticket counters at the metro stations. Thanks to Hyderabad Metro Rail we would now be able to help metro riders to travel conveniently and book tickets on the go", he said adding Paytm provides multiple products and services like Metro Card recharges, mobile-based ticketing and trip pass for Bengaluru Metro, Hyderabad Metro, Delhi Metro, and Mumbai Metro. Also, it is the first company to launch QR-based tickets for Mumbai Metro and is expanding this service to other major cities as well. (NSS)
